Westwood's caddie has surgery, may miss U.S. Open
- By Rex Hoggard
- May 8, 2012 6:17 PM ET

PONTE VEDRA BEACH, Fla. – Lee Westwood begins his second week with fill-in caddie Cayce Kerr on the bag; it’s a stint that may stretch deep into golf’s major championship season.
According to Westwood’s management team at International Sports Management his regular looper, Billy Foster (pictured above), had surgery on his right knee on Tuesday. Foster injured his anterior cruciate ligament in a soccer match last week in Charlotte, N.C., and flew home to England for surgery.
Westwood’s manager, Chubby Chandler, said Foster will be out at least four weeks and perhaps longer, which would likely keep him off the bag for next month’s U.S. Open.
Kerr has been working for Fred Couples, who withdrew from this week’s Players Championship with the flu.
